Whenever someone decides to review the new licensing
stuff in mobile, let me
know. It requires updating both MobileFrontend and WikimediaMessages, and
takes a fair bit of work to test all the combinations and interfaces.
The 5 interfaces are:
* Wikitext editor
* VisualEditor
* Talk page add new section
* Talk page add new comment to section
* Upload file
The variables for the combinations are:
* WikimediaMessages on or off
* $wgRightsUrl set or not set
* $wgRightsText set to various licenses (cc-by-sa has special importance for
WikimediaMessages)
* Terms of Use set or not set
* $wgRightsPage set or not set
* Various i18n messages overridden locally
I can help whoever is reviewing to walk through these. I didn't write
acceptance tests since the functionality is non-critical (it's basically
been broken for years), and it would require a shitload of tests to test
effectively. If someone thinks it should have acceptance tests though, let
me know.
